Collision Tumors of Ovary: A Rare Entity


 

Mature cystic teratoma of the ovary, contains derivatives of all three embryonic germ cell layers, rarely presents together with ovarian epithelial or sex cord-stromal tumors. In the available literature there is one similar case report in a non-child bearing young women. We report here a rare case of collision tumour of ovary comprising of bilateral mature cystic teratoma with serous cystadenoma right ovary in a 18 year-old girl.
